FXCM and LegacyFX are two online brokers with distinct regulatory profiles. Founded in 1999, FXCM is publicly traded, with a high Trust Score of 95 out of 99 from ForexBrokers.com, reflecting a high level of trust. FXCM is not a bank but stands out with four Tier-1 licenses and two Tier-2 licenses, suggesting it is well-regulated and considered highly trustworthy. In terms of regulatory standing, this positions FXCM as a reliable choice for traders seeking a broker with strong compliance credentials.
On the other hand, LegacyFX, established in 2012, is not publicly traded and holds a ForexBrokers.com Trust Score of 67, placing it in the high-risk category. Like FXCM, LegacyFX is not a bank, but it holds only one Tier-1 license and lacks Tier-2 licenses. This limited regulatory oversight might be a concern for traders who prioritize safety and compliance. While LegacyFX is a younger company, its regulatory footprint is smaller, which can imply a different risk profile compared to more established brokers like FXCM.

FXCM's forex trading fees are slightly above the industry average, with standard account spreads averaging 0.78 pips on the EUR/USD for its EU, U.K., and Australia offerings. For their broker license in St. Vincent and the Grenadines, spreads rise to 1.38 pips. However, commission-based accounts see significantly lower spreads, averaging 0.28 pips, with potential for further discounts through FXCM’s Active Trader Rebate Program, which offers rebates between $5 and $25 per million traded based on volume and tier. With a four-star rating for commissions and fees, FXCM stands at number 24 out of 63 brokers in the category, helped by low underlying spreads that increase slightly when commission-equivalent costs are added.
LegacyFX provides varying account offerings depending on your location, with three primary account types for EU clients—Silver, Gold, and Platinum—requiring minimum deposits of $500, $5,000, and $25,000, respectively. While the Platinum account offers the lowest spreads, the Silver account incurs significantly higher costs, with spreads on the EUR/USD beginning at 1.6 pips. For international traders under the Vanuatu entity, LegacyFX offers seven account types from Standard to VIP, which influence levels of client support and access to trading tools. Holding a 3.5-star rating, LegacyFX is ranked 57 out of 63 brokers for commissions and fees.
In summary, while FXCM offers competitive commission-based pricing, particularly for active traders willing to meet volume requirements, LegacyFX varies its rates based on account type and location but lacks transparency in average spread information. FXCM might be a more suitable option for traders focused on minimizing fees with its rebate programs, while LegacyFX caters to those who value a range of account types and support levels, but with potentially higher trading costs.

When it comes to the variety of available investments, FXCM and LegacyFX offer similar experiences for traders, each granting access to an array of trading options. Both platforms support forex trading as CFDs or spot contracts, allowing users the flexibility to maneuver through various market conditions. FXCM features 440 tradeable symbols, slightly edging out LegacyFX, which offers 425. However, LegacyFX offers one more forex pair than FXCM, with a total of 44 pairs. Importantly for global investors, neither broker provides direct access to exchange-traded securities on U.S. or international exchanges.
For those interested in cryptocurrency investments via derivatives, both FXCM and LegacyFX meet expectations but stop short of offering the ability to purchase the actual digital assets. When considering socially-oriented trading, both platforms support copy trading, enabling users to mimic the strategies of more experienced traders. These similarities culminate in identical ratings for the range of investments, with both FXCM and LegacyFX receiving 3.5 stars. Nonetheless, FXCM and LegacyFX place at #47 and #48, respectively, in ForexBrokers.com's rankings. Such metrics imply they cater to a broad yet comparable range of investment opportunities.

When comparing the trading platforms and tools of FXCM and LegacyFX, it is clear that both brokers offer options that cater to a range of traders. FXCM stands out with its proprietary platform alongside offering the widely used MetaTrader 4 (MT4), whereas LegacyFX provides support for MetaTrader 5 (MT5) only. Both platforms give users the convenience of web-based and Windows-based desktop trading opportunities, as well as the benefit of free virtual demo accounts for simulated trading. In the realm of copy trading, both brokers provide this service; however, FXCM includes ZuluTrade in its offerings, which is not available with LegacyFX.
Regarding charting capabilities, LegacyFX provides more drawing tools on its platform, offering 15 compared to FXCM’s 10. In contrast, FXCM allows for a more detailed watch list with 13 available fields compared to LegacyFX's 7. Additionally, both brokers support direct trading from stock charts, making transactions seamless for users. Ranking and reviews further underscore FXCM’s superior offering in this category, with a 5-star rating and a 6th place ranking out of 63 brokers by ForexBrokers.com. LegacyFX, with a 3.5-star rating and a 60th place ranking, suggests room for enhancement in its trading platforms and tools offering.

When comparing the mobile trading apps of FXCM and LegacyFX, both brokers offer apps for iPhone and Android users, ensuring accessibility for all. They each provide features like stock and forex price alerts, trendline drawing, multiple time frame viewing, and real-time quote watchlists. However, FXCM stands out with its watchlist symbol syncing capabilities, allowing users to seamlessly sync their watchlists between their mobile app and online accounts—a feature LegacyFX lacks. Additionally, FXCM impresses with 59 technical studies available for charting, nearly doubling the 30 offered by LegacyFX.
FXCM's commitment to a comprehensive mobile trading experience is reflected in its higher rating, receiving 4.5 stars compared to LegacyFX's 3.5 stars. This is further underscored by FXCM's placement as the 16th best mobile trading app out of 63 brokers, a stark contrast to LegacyFX's position at 61st. For traders prioritizing a feature-rich and highly rated mobile platform, FXCM emerges as the more favorable choice.

FXCM and LegacyFX both provide valuable resources for investors seeking market insights. Offering daily market commentary and forex news from prestigious sources like Bloomberg and Reuters, both brokers ensure traders stay informed on key market developments. They also feature economic calendars to help predict market shifts. However, FXCM stands out by providing access to Trading Central tools and a sentiment-based trading tool, which gives traders detailed insights into market dynamics. Additionally, FXCM offers market research from TipRanks, further enhancing its research services.
While LegacyFX does provide technical analysis tools from Autochartist, it lacks some features that FXCM includes. Despite having a comprehensive offering with similar foundational tools, LegacyFX does not have Trading Central or sentiment tools, contributing to its lower research rating of 3.5 stars, compared to FXCM's 4.5 stars. As a result, FXCM ranks 11th out of 63 brokers in the Research category according to ForexBrokers.com, while LegacyFX holds the 46th position.
